Description
Early chapel site, walled churchyard on raised knoll with many fine 17th and 18th century carved gravestones and 1830 rectangular mausoleum to Keith family. Rubble boundary walls.
MAUSOLEUM: 1830 (dated), a simplified version of the Mar Mausoleum at Alloa, probably by James Gillespie Graham. Rectangular Gothic buttressed mausoleum; finely stugged ashlar with polished dressings, margins and buttresses. Pointed arch doorway with hoodmould to south gable, studded timber door. Small lancet to gable head, hoodmoulded with mask label stops. Buttressed blind flanks. Eaves cornice, chunky crowstepped gables, slate roof partially collapsed.
Interior: memorial tablets and slabs to Keith family.
